Five unmissable ways to make the most of Margate

Eight years ago, the then-forgotten town of Margate wouldn’t have even made a blip on travellers’ radars. Today, this seaside resort couldn’t be further from its days of dereliction. A massive regeneration project started in 2011 has planted this colourful, unhurried spot firmly back on the map as a must-visit destination for art, independent shopping and local gastronomy – all within easy reach of London.
